Will my yard be damaged during the repair?
The extent of yard damage during a sewer line repair largely depends on the method used. Rosenthal Water Softeners & Treatment offers both traditional excavation and trenchless repair methods.
Traditional excavation involves digging trenches to access and repair the sewer line, which can cause noticeable disruption to your yard. While we strive to minimize damage, the area where we dig will be disturbed. After completing the repair, we restore your yard as best as possible, replanting the grass and smoothing out the surface to leave it in a condition as close to its original state as feasible.
On the other hand, trenchless repair methods are designed to minimize yard damage. Techniques such as pipe relining or pipe bursting involve creating small access points and performing the repair with minimal digging. These methods are less invasive and significantly reduce the impact on your landscaping.

How can I prevent future sewer line problems?
Preventing future sewer line problems involves regular maintenance and mindful practices. One of the most effective ways to protect your sewer line is to schedule periodic inspections and cleanings. Being mindful of what goes down your drains is also crucial. Avoid flushing non-degradable items, such as wipes, feminine hygiene products, and paper towels, which can cause clogs. Grease, oils, and large food particles should be kept out of your kitchen drains, as they can solidify and create blockages within your pipes.
Tree roots are a common cause of sewer line damage. If you have large trees near your sewer line, consider installing root barriers or having your sewer line inspected regularly to check for root intrusion. Trenchless technology can sometimes be used to repair root-damaged pipes without the need for extensive digging.
Additionally, if your home has older pipes, it might be worth considering a sewer line replacement to prevent issues related to aging infrastructure. By taking these proactive steps, you can significantly reduce the risk of future sewer line problems and maintain a healthy plumbing system.
